Summary

This gene encodes an enzyme that catalyzes the hydrolysis of sulfate esters by oxidizing a cysteine residue in the substrate sulfatase to an active site 3-oxoalanine residue, which is also known as C-alpha-formylglycine. Mutations in this gene cause multiple sulfatase deficiency, a lysosomal storage disorder.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2009]

Forensic Context

A single-nucleus transcriptomics study of human postmortem nucleus accumbens tissue identified the SUMF1 as a protein-coding gene significantly upregulated in microglia (MGL) cell types from individuals with alcohol use disorder compared to controls [Van Den Oord et al. DOI:10.1111/Adb.13250].
